About A. Andrighetto
A. Andrighetto is a scholar working on Radiation, Materials Chemistry, Aerospace Engineering, Electrical and Electronic Engineering and Nuclear and High Energy Physics, having authored 125 papers that have together received 1.2k indexed citations. Recurring topics across this work include Nuclear Physics and Applications (60 papers), Particle accelerators and beam dynamics (30 papers), Nuclear Materials and Properties (26 papers), Nuclear reactor physics and engineering (19 papers), Nuclear physics research studies (13 papers), Ion-surface interactions and analysis (12 papers), Atomic and Molecular Physics (12 papers) and Radiopharmaceutical Chemistry and Applications (12 papers). The work is most often cited by research in Radiation (488 citations), Nuclear and High Energy Physics (318 citations), Ceramics and Composites (81 citations), Aerospace Engineering (317 citations) and Materials Chemistry (485 citations). A. Andrighetto has collaborated with scholars based in Italy, United States and Russia. Frequent co-authors include M. Manzolaro, S. Corradetti, Lisa Biasetto, S. Carturan, G. Prete, D. Scarpa, Paolo Colombo, Giovanni Meneghetti, A. Monetti and P. Zanonato. Their work appears in journals such as The European Physical Journal A, Review of Scientific Instruments, Nuclear Instruments and Methods in Physics Research Section B Beam Interactions with Materials and Atoms, Applied Radiation and Isotopes and Journal of Nuclear Materials.
